In the pharmaceutical distribution system everyone takes their own vigorish from every pill which is dispensed. In matters where Medicare or Medicaid is involved these thieves really gouge the public spigot.

In the flow of payment from drug manufacturer to consumer, several parties receive compensation: drug manufacturers receive payment for selling drugs to wholesalers, who in turn sell to pharmacies, and ultimately, the consumer pays the pharmacy. Pharmacies, wholesalers, pharmacy benefit managers (PBMs), and insurers also receive payments or rebates from manufacturers or each other, impacting the final cost to the consumer.
